With the BlackBerry Storm’s release date this month, it looks like Verizon is about to add some more action to the month other than RIM’s latest smartphone.
Blogs and technology sites are alight with rumor that Verizon will be launching new data plans on November 14, these documents apparently leaked onto the Howard forums show PaysAsYou Go data plans being eliminated.
How will these new data plans affect the BlackBerry Storm? It seems that new smartphones will be prevented from having Pay As You Go, a 10MB data plan or 1X Block after November 14, 2008. This also means new devices will require a data plan of $29.99 or more.
The new BlackBerry Storm will be highly subsidized and this helps with ending Pay As You Go data access. You can read more details here.
